The Motor Yachts range soon be built by Chantier Naval Couach

The three powercat models in Fountaine Pajot’s Motor Yacht range (MY4S, MY5 and MY6) are to be manufactured by the Couach shipyard from October.

Founded in 1897 and based in Gujan-Mestras, on the shores of the Bay of Arcachon in southwest France, Couach designs and builds yachts and coastal surveillance vessels ranging from 11 to 50 meters in length. This unprecedented agreement will mean Fountaine Pajot can free up capacity for the production of its larger catamarans (Samana 59, Alegria 67 and Power 67) at its base in La Rochelle. The Aigrefeuille shipyard is dedicated to intermediate-sized sailing models and the Périgny shipyard to Dufour monohulls. This arrangement will surely flourish, given the pressure on order books and the legitimate reluctance to make heavy investments, and could significantly increase the builders’ production.
